Our Location - Italian Market Deli
×
Home Page
Sandwiches
Pizza
From Our Kitchen
From Our Deli
Party Platters
Our Location
Go to content
Our Location
09159663539
530-1583
admin@imdeli.com
A registered trademark of
RICERCA INC
At the Entrance to DZR Airport
Brgy. 88, San Jose
Tacloban City, Leyte 6500
Open: Tuesday - Sunday 9 am - 9 pm
Back to content
To use this website you must enable JavaScript.